摘要
Aim: Our study aims to provide a more holistic understanding of the available data and predictive risk factors for gastrointestinal bleed (GIB). Materials & methods: We searched MEDLINE, Embase, Cochrane Central Register of Controlled Trials and Web of Science Core Collection and calculated relative risk and meta-regression was utilized to evaluate for risk factors in order to assess the effect of covariates. Results: Our meta-analysis reported a pooled prevalence rate of GIB of 24.4%. Meta-regression analysis did not yield a statistically significant association between GIB and risk factors, including age, gender, hypertension, chronic kidney disease and diabetes. Conclusion: Studies investigating larger sample sizes are required for conclusive findings. Plain language summary: Left ventricular assist devices are used for the circulation of blood throughout the body in cases where the left ventricle is not able to do so. After such a device is implanted, gastrointestinal (GI) bleeding has been reported which raises serious concerns for complications. Our study found that 24.4% of the total population reported GI bleed after implantation and that there is no significant association of GI bleed with the patient's age, gender and being diagnosed with diabetes mellitus, hypertension or chronic kidney disease. Non association of these conditions with GI bleed requires further investigation in the form of larger patient data for conclusive findings.
